Understanding the Mechanics of DAOs
Decentralized Autonomous Organizations (DAOs) are innovative entities fueled by blockchain technology. They operate autonomously through smart contracts, a set of pre-programmed instructions that govern the organization's decisions. Members participate in DAO governance by casting ballots on proposals, shaping the direction of the organization. DAOs offer a novel structure for collaboration, equalizing decision-making and fostering visibility.
- DAOs harness blockchain technology to provide secure, transparent, and tamper-proof transaction logging.
- Digital representation plays a crucial role in DAO governance. Members acquire tokens that indicate their ownership within the organization.
